- [ ] Master keys for the Branlow Street depot: grab the whole ring from the key safe before the off-site run, not just the gate set — last time we split them and it was a mess. Count them (should be nine), bag them, and sign the log so Marta doesn't chase us again. The courier from Velmire Transit will meet you at Dock 2, and the hand-over instruction below must be followed exactly.

dispatch memo: the lamwyn fenwyn courier leaves the wenir ledger at gate 7175 under passcode 822969

Uploaded text files in Parsewell are run through the charset-sniffer service before storage. Detection uses byte-order marks first, then statistical heuristics; anything below the confidence threshold is quarantined rather than guessed. Note that the sniffer never executes content and strips NUL bytes on ingest. Review findings related to encoding bypasses should be filed with the platform security group, reachable at the address below.

escalation mailbox, yajeg-bageg: quenax.olidor@lumiccorp.internal

### Ticket: Config drift caused query planner regression

Flagging for the sync: the planner regression we chased last week on Marrowgate turned out to be config drift, not a code change. Staging had the updated statistics target and join reordering flags; prod was still running values from the March rollout, so the planner picked a nested-loop plan on the big orders table and latency tripled. We need to reconcile the two environments and add a drift check to CI. For reference, prod is currently running with these settings.

deployment values, faduf-tawep:
SORDOR_LOG_LEVEL=error
SORDOR_METRICS_HOST=metrics.sordor.nelvrolabs.internal
SORDOR_POOL_SIZE=4

// MAX_PENDING_HALL_CALLS caps the dispatch queue in the Cartwheel
// elevator simulator. Yes, 64 looks arbitrary — it isn't. Anything
// higher lets a hostile tenant script flood the scheduler and starve
// legit calls, which is exactly the DoS vector flagged in the Oakhurst
// review. Don't bump this without re-running the saturation fuzzer;
// the queue math assumes it fits in a single page. If you're auditing
// this, the relevant fuzz run is pinned to the build tagged below.

trace token, fafog-faduf: htk3_4e2